Book excerpt: Agricultural engineering principles and practices is an exposition on a previous work titled; fundamental principles of agricultural engineering practice published by same author in 2007 which only explored aspects of principles of agricultural engineering with less emphasis on production practices engaged in at every level of agricultural operations. Thus the book gave a narrowed outlook of agricultural engineering fundamentals, which is not adequate for providing relevant information in practice with agricultural engineering background undertaking at all levels of engineering training in the university, polytechnic and colleges. Hence, the book has been enlarged in scopes and packaged in 2 volume titles (11 chapters in Volume I and 9 chapters in Volume II). Volume (I) has three parts that addresses fundamental aspects of agricultural engineering: Part 1 has six chapters comprising of agricultural engineering development, issues on agricultural mechanization, management of engineering utilities, economics of machine use, farm power and agricultural machinery and development. Part 2, in 3 chapters, addresses all aspects of site surveying, land clearing undertakings and landform development, various agricultural practices, and tillage operations. Part 3 has 2 chapters on crop planting operations and establishment practices. Various planting patterns and characteristics, equipment types and planter component descriptions are features x-rayed in this section. Chapters 10 and 11 dwells much on post planting operations involving crop thinning, fertilizer application, pest and weed control programme, and new development in chemical and fertilizer application as well as integrated pest control management. Book excerpt: Explores soil as a nexus for water, chemicals, and biologically coupled nutrient cycling Soil is a narrow but critically important zone on Earth's surface. It is the interface for water and carbon recycling from above and part of the cycling of sediment and rock from below. Hydrogeology, Chemical Weathering, and Soil Formation places chemical weathering and soil formation in its geological, climatological, biological and hydrological perspective. Volume highlights include: The evolution of soils over 3.25 billion years Basic processes contributing to soil formation How chemical weathering and soil formation relate to water and energy fluxes The role of pedogenesis in geomorphology Relationships between climate soils and biota Soils, aeolian deposits, and crusts as geologic dating tools Impacts of land-use change on soils The American Geophysical Union promotes discovery in Earth and space science for the benefit of humanity.
